Paper Title: Integrated Fish Farming: A simple, cost-effective technology to ensure employment, food and nutritional security for marginal and small hill farmers.

Abstract: Integrated Fish Farming (IFF) is a sustainable and eco-friendly approach that combines fish farming with other agricultural practices, such as poultry farming, mushroom, livestock rearing, crop production and other systems that are mutually supportive. Sequential linkages between different farming activities are established in such a way that the waste from one biological system serves as nutrients for another biological system. Such integration thus ensures optimum utilization of available resources and results in maximum and diversified farm output making IFF a profitable venture. To make farming activities economically viable and ecologically sustainable, several multi-enterprise IFF models relevant to small and marginal hill farmers were developed and evaluated on farmers’ fields over the last two decades. Exotic fish; silver carp, grass carp and common carp were stocked at 45:35:25 into the pond, due to their known compatibility with each other, faster growth and resistance to biotic and abiotic stress. Chick birds of a dual-purpose hybrid Kuroiler, a hardy breed of chicken raised for both egg and meat were stocked. Small scale IFF models created in hill region enables the agricultural production system productive, profitable and sustainable. Nutritional requirement of the system is self- sustained through resource recycling. Besides year round employment and substantial monetary gain, the farmer’s family got fresh vegetables and good quality animal protein, which has improved nutritional status of the household. Various IFF models evaluated during last two decades clearly indicated that IFF approach holds high promise as an instrument to provide food security, nutritional benefits, employment and income generation to resource poor farmers. Moreover, The IFF technology compliments cropping activities of small farmers, diversifies farming activities and generate employment and income, thus leading to enhanced nutrition, social and economic uplift of the society.In this paper,current agricultural situation in Uttarakhand hills, IFF technology and its potential to sustain agriculture in hills, constraints in adopting the technology and future thrust is discussed
